Sambro village, Nova Scotia
PH2009:0005:080
Description:
Note inscribed on verso of photograph by Hunter: "Historical village. This village reportedly is no longer in existance, having been desimated by a hurricane several years after photo was made. [...]. I am told lighthouse is all that remains." Another note by artist on post-it affixed to photograph: "Village swept away in Hurricane. Only lighthouse remains."

ARCH273328
Description:
Group consists of photographs (including 3 contact sheets) of the members of the Minimum Cost Housing Group making sulphur concrete and sulphur concrete bricks, and photographs of installation, tools and devices for making concrete and bricks, including some used for the publications about sulphur concrete.
ca. 1974
